Meet Ben Council

A broad perspective. A focused commitment to justice.

Ben Council’s professional background spans healthcare, real estate and law. He earned a Bachelor of Arts in Biology from the University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ill, a Master’s Degree in Healthcare Administration and a Juris Doctor, graduating magna cum laude from Southern University Law Center.

That multidisciplinary experience informs a practical approach to serious injury, financial and property-related legal matters while maintaining a strong commitment to equitable access to legal resources.

Healthcare BackgroundMore than fifteen years in healthcare before entering legal practice.
Real Estate ExperienceExperience as an agent, appraisal trainee and real estate investor.
Legal EducationJuris Doctor, magna cum laude, Southern University Law Center.
Community CommitmentVolunteer legal service for unrepresented and underserved people in New Orleans.
